Police codes explained
The following codes appeared in the transcript and are explained below:
[1]
901T: Traffic collision with injuries requiring medical or ambulance response.
[2]
902R: Rescue or emergency medical response requested, often for injury or medical emergency situations.
[3]
Code 3: Emergency response; proceed immediately with lights and siren.
